Beijing Business Daily (Reporter Meng Fanxia, Zhou Yili) — On March 6, Chengdu Bank announced that its convertible bonds will be redeemed early and delisted on February 6, 2025. The bank’s total shares will increase to 4.238 billion. Previously, the bank had submitted an application to the Sichuan Financial Regulatory Bureau for a change in registered capital. Recently, the bank received the “Reply from Sichuan Financial Regulatory Bureau on Chengdu Bank’s Change of Registered Capital,” approving the increase of the company’s registered capital from 3.736 billion RMB to 4.238 billion RMB. Chengdu Bank stated that it will handle the registration change procedures for the increase in registered capital according to relevant regulations.
